Iga Swiatek vs. Angelique Kerber Prediction, Odds, Picks for WTA Italian Open 2024

Iga Swiatek will square off with Angelique Kerber in the round of 16 at the WTA Rome event on Monday.

Swiatek vs. Kerber Game Information

The WTA Italian Open match between Iga Swiatek and Angelique Kerber is scheduled to start on Monday at 9:00AM ET.

  • Who: Iga Swiatek vs. Angelique Kerber
  • Date: Monday, May 13, 2024
  • Approx. Time: 9:00AM ET / 6:00AM PT
  • Tournament: WTA Rome, Italy Women's Singles 2024
  • Round: Round of 16
